This B&B is in an excellent location inside the walls and on one of the streets that circle Piazza Antifeatro, and also is close to one of the gates into the piazza. There are restaurants galore on that street, and in the piazza itself. The piazza is a busy spot, but we heard no noise from it. Our room had a comfortable queen bed, ample storage, AC, a reasonable size modern bathroom with a walk-in shower. The artwork on the walls of our room portrayed memorable Lucca landmarks which added character to the space. The breakfast was good -- lots of choices, and one of the owners on site to make you an expresso or cappuccino. Check-in was straightforward. Our cab was able to drop us nearby, and a city bus stop is a short walk away. On our previous stay in Lucca we stayed in a b&b that was close to the Duomo. We found the Antifeatro location to be preferable.
This is not a criticism, just something to be aware of if your mobility is not what it once was -- the B&B is 12 stairs up from the door at the street.

I was travelling for only 5 days around Tuscany with my teenager son. Unfortunately we were short of time so we could spend only one night in the beautiful medieval town of Lucca. I have found the B&B "Anfiteatro" through Booking.com and I'm so pleased for choosing this B&B. The location is excellent just beside the Anfiteatro round square. The "Borgo" of Lucca looks small but there are so many hidden landmarks to discover, every corner has an history mainly from Romanic and Renaissance times. There are beautiful Romanic and Renaissance churches and Towers. The Historical centre is very alive but we felt very safe in Lucca compared to other places like Pisa or Florence of course bigger cities. I recommend to stay in Lucca even to visit Pisa or reach the beach locations. The train will take you to Pisa in just half hour or to Viareggio. Florence is an hour away by train. The B&B Anfiteatro is a family home owned by two brothers, Luca and Marco, who are extremely nice and helpful. They have done an amazing restoration work but left the authentic Italian old fashion countryside houses, yet adding all the comfortable moderne features inside the structure. Our room had a mini fridge, air-conditioning, free Wi-Fi, smart TV, a new powerful shower and bathroom but the style of the room was still present. The breakfast was actually the best we had while travelling in Tuscany the past 5 days. Fresh homemade Italian cakes, eggs, fresh cheeses, bread, charcuterie, juices,coffees...really beautifully presented. Luca and Marco can help you with tips on where to eat and what to do in Lucca. When I'll visit Lucca again, I'll definitely book their B&B. Tips: if you can travel to Lucca in early Spring or Fall months, not too hot and too overcrowded. Thank you so much for the lovely stay. Location was fantastic, and yet room was quiet. Staff were helpful and kindly prepared a takeaway breakfast for me one morning, at my request.
It was more difficult to coordinate further travel plans than I thought - I was told I could leave a bag after check out but then told on the day that I tried to do so that the office is closed from 11am to 3pm, meaning I would not be able to collect the bag until after 3pm. I had a bus to catch before then so had to take my luggage with me at 10.30am check out and sit in a square for a few hours. This would be very inconvenient if you had to wait the full 4 hours! Also, breakfast starts at 8.30 which makes it difficult to coordinate catching trains if you are taking a day trip (particularly to Florence). However, the staff kindly prepared a takeaway breakfast for me the night before, at my request.
